The newest spinoff manga of “That Time I Got Reincarnated as a Slime,” titled “Tensei Shitara Slime Datta Ken: Toaru Kyūka no Sugoshi-kata” (That Time I Got Reincarnated as a Slime: How to Spend a Certain Vacation), is set to end in the next issue of Kodansha’s Monthly Shonen Sirius magazine on May 26, 2025.
